From 8553fc9aa0193328f9fdd440beb547a7fc257010 Mon Sep 17 00:00:00 2001 From: Tomas Lindquist Olsen Date: Sun, 30 Nov 2008 20:41:17 +0100 Subject: [PATCH] Fixed ModuleInfo patch check, failed on 64bit --- gen/toobj.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/gen/toobj.cpp b/gen/toobj.cpp index e4addcbe..8b1c83df 100644 --- a/gen/toobj.cpp +++ b/gen/toobj.cpp @@ -697,7 +697,7 @@ void Module::genmoduleinfo() DtoForceConstInitDsymbol(moduleinfo); // check for patch - if (moduleinfo->ir.irStruct->constInit->getNumOperands() != 11) + if (moduleinfo->fields.dim != 9) { error("unpatched object.d detected, ModuleInfo incorrect"); fatal();